This college is located on Vellore chittoor road with a beautiful mountains on the back of the building. Very quite place. They have huge infrastructures. Departments wise different building, separate laboratories. Huge ground for encouraging students on sports. This is owned by DMK minister Mr. Duraimurugan. Unfortunately the quality of education is not up to the mark. This college had been featured in Anna University's non performing( very poor result) college list for 2018-2019.
